[TGS 2017] Left Alive: Metal Gear Solid, Except It’s Not [VIDEO]

Going by the artwork, anyone would say that it’s a Metal Gear Solid title. However, it isn’t that!

The thought, however, makes sense. Before the Tokyo Game Show starts, Sony held its press conference, announcing many games, and Left Alive was one of them. The survival shooter will be published by Square Enix on PlayStation 4 and PC, and its development is led by Toshifumi Nabeshima (director, previously working on the Armored Core series), Yoji Shinkawa (character designer, Metal Gear series!), and Takayuki Yanase (mech designer, former work includes Ghost in the Shell: Arise, Mobile Suit Gundam 00, Xenoblade Chronicles X). Look at that image below: Shinkawa’s style is present! The producer deserves a separate mention: it’s going to be Shinji Hashimoto… known for Kingdom Hearts and Final Fantasy!

On September 20, at 7 PM Pacific, 10 PM Eastern / September 21, 3 AM UK, 4 AM CET, there will be a live stream held on YouTube here about the game, which is launching in 2018.
